so when a user is on the facebook mobile app and clicks on a link, e.g. in an ad, Facebook seems to use their own browser and the user agent gets a Facebook-y add-on like [FB_IAB/FB4A;FBAV/371.0.0.24.109
Would it be possible to "force" the user out of the facebook browser into his normal default browser somehow? Basically let's say user clicks on ad. Webpage opens in the facebook browser. On that webpage in the facebook browser is another link. I want this link to be opened in the default browser, not the normal browser.
Is that possible?
